Introduced in 1967, the Rolex Sea-Dweller was developed in collaboration with professional deep-sea divers to meet the demands of saturation diving. Building on the success of the Submariner, it featured increased water resistance and the introduction of the helium escape valve, allowing trapped gas to safely exit the case during decompression. Designed as a true professional tool watch, the Sea-Dweller has remained purpose-built throughout its evolution, favouring functionality and robustness over embellishment. Today, it stands as one of Rolex’s most technically significant and respected sports watches.

This Rolex Sea-Dweller reference 1665 is the highly coveted Double Red variant, instantly recognised by the two lines of red text on the dial and regarded as one of the most important Sea-Dwellers ever produced. Dating to 1973, the matte black dial is beautifully preserved, with a crisp date aperture and iconic Mercedes hands filled with rich, butter-yellow luminous material that has aged evenly across the oversized hour plots.
The stainless steel case and Oyster bracelet remain in superb condition, showing only light signs of wear consistent with age, while retaining strong lines and excellent overall definition. The bezel is well preserved with clear markings and a sharp serrated edge. Supplied with its original box and papers, this Double Red Sea-Dweller is powered by Rolex’s calibre 1570 automatic movement and is offered with a 12-month warranty — a truly exceptional example of a landmark Rolex professional model.
